撰寫命理程式一定要先掌握它所提供的 "命盤基本元素" , 再運用這些基本元素去排列組合, 才能隨心所欲, 下列範例所運用的基本元素, 在命理程式說明裡都有, 舉例如下:
如果八字中無某十星,而在地支藏干中有,該如何表達成立;
如果:((正財是:生年支的星1,生年支的星2,生年支的星3)||
(正財是:生月支的星1,生月支的星2,生月支的星3)||
(正財是:生時支的星1,生時支的星2,生時支的星3)||
(偏財是:生年支的星1,生年支的星2,生年支的星3)||
(偏財是:生月支的星1,生月支的星2,生月支的星3)||
(偏財是:生時支的星1,生時支的星2,生時支的星3))&&
不是(正財的天干是:生年干,生月干,生時干)&&不是(偏財的天干是:生年干,生月干,生時干)
還有,就是該如何表示藏干在那一柱地支上
如果:甲是:生年支的藏1,生年支的藏2,生年支的藏3
又如八字中的祿神有好幾個,該如何表達,是否應表示為:
如果 :祿神的數量>=3
八字的旺衰也還有數量的不清楚,是否可以表示為,比肩的旺度>500以上或超過忌神的旺衰,就算身旺,是否可以表現為:比肩的旺衰>旺
若身弱表示為:比肩的旺衰<旺
若八字天干及地支中僅有一位十星且該如何表示;是否表示為:
年,月,日,時比肩數量=1
年,月,日,時比肩數量=0
這樣可以嗎?謝謝
撰寫提示參考:
十星的數量可運用 "陣列" 將其數量儲存, 再往後程式皆可運用, 若您有程式基礎應該不難實現.